HSRC Repository
The HSRC Institutional Repository is an important tool that the HSRC utilises to preserve and disseminate its documents. Different types of publications including scholarly research outputs are collected, preserved and distributed in a digital format.
Research data
The HSRC Research Data Service provides a digital repository of the HSRC's research data in support of evidence-based human and social development.
